top of page

Cross Platform Application Development Services

Invatechs has over 10+ years of experience in cross-platform app development for various business niches. We have experience in Fintech, Logistics, eCommerce, Real Estate, Restaurants, etc. Invatechs is proficient in a variety of cross-platform app development frameworks, including C#, JavaScript, TypeScript, and Dart, which are essential for creating native cross-platform apps for Android, iOS, and Windows.

Cross-platform App Development

Cross-platform is a term used to describe an approach to development in which a single code base is used to create applications that run on multiple platforms or operating systems, such as iOS, Android, and the Web. This makes app development faster and more cost-effective since there is no need to write different codes for each platform.

communication social media

The best solutions for the Cross-platform app

A cross-platform application is a perfect solution for many business niches. Our professionals have development experience in many niche areas, where they have used the best patterns and trending ideas to implement complex and feature-rich applications. 

Incorporating cross platform mobile development into your strategy can significantly enhance efficiency, cost-effectiveness, and ensure consistent user experiences across iOS and Android platforms, thanks to the use of a single codebase for multiplatform development.

The cross-platform app provides companies with the tools and resources needed to create a secure and flexible solution in each of these industries.

close-up-hands-holding-smartphon

Want a successful Cross-platform app?

Discuss your idea with our experts

What are the benefits of having a cross-platform app for a business?

Every business can face limited budgets and deadlines, and cross-platform applications fit perfectly into this paradigm. Our experts can create the perfect solution that will cover all your needs. The targeted benefits of a cross-platform app for your business include the following: A cross-platform mobile app allows businesses to provide their services on multiple mobile operating systems using a single codebase, ensuring a wider reach and streamlined development process.

Increased brand awareness and recognition

A company can reach a larger audience and increase its market share by creating an app that works across multiple platforms, such as iOS and Android. In addition, a well-designed cross-platform app can also provide a positive user experience, leading to increased customer satisfaction and brand loyalty.

Saving time and cost

Cross-platform app development streamlines the development process by eliminating the need to write separate code for each platform, thereby reducing development costs and time to market. This approach not only maximizes efficiency in the development process but also ensures a faster and more efficient outcome. On the same side, it is an ideal option for projects with a limited budget since cross-platform application development requires less investment. Learn more about the benefits of cross-platform development.

Efficiency in maintenance

One of the benefits of cross-platform application development is the ease of maintenance. Since a single code base is used to create an application running on multiple platforms, only one version of the code needs to be updated and maintained. This saves time and resources compared to maintaining separate code bases for each platform and can lead to a more efficient and streamlined maintenance process.

What is the process of custom Cross-platform App Development?

Invatechs is always based on an individual approach to each client, and this helps to achieve the best results in mobile app development, particularly in the realm of cross-platform mobile app development. We always treat the issue of data security responsibly and always have an NDA agreement in place, after which we proceed with the collaboration. The process of custom cross-platform application development usually includes the following steps:

Full-cycle Delivery Team
Workflow

1

Requirements gathering and analysis

During this stage, all project requirements are gathered, and a development roadmap is created together with our customers.

Design

2

At this stage, the user interface and the application's overall design are created and agreed upon with the client. The application's layout is created and can be interacted with for a general understanding of its structure.

Development

3

This is the main stage where the application is developed and tested for functionality. App development uses the frameworks chosen for the project, which allow for native app development with a single codebase that can run on both iOS and Android platforms. These frameworks enable the creation of native apps, ensuring they provide high-performance user experiences across multiple platforms.

Testing

4

At this stage, the app is thoroughly tested to make sure that it works as expected on both platforms, including verifying the integration of native code with the cross-platform codebase to ensure seamless performance. After testing, the app is deployed to app stores (such as the Apple App Store and Google Play Store).

5

Deployment

In this stage, the app is deployed to the Google Play Store or other app stores and made available to users.

6

Maintenance and support

Once the app is launched, it is important to keep it up to date and to fix any bugs that arise. Ongoing maintenance and updates are necessary to keep the app running smoothly and attract users.

Main Technologies

Our effective solutions are aimed at creating user-friendly and functional platforms and websites. Professionals from Invatechs use the most cutting-edge techniques to deploy and improve web products.

Modern cross platform frameworks and tools for creating cross-platform apps allow our developers to create high-quality apps. They can run on multiple platforms, such as iOS and Android, using a single codebase. Our core stack when developing cross-platform apps includes React Native, PhoneGap, Xamarin, Flutter, and Cordova, highlighting the versatility and efficiency of utilizing cross-platform frameworks to reach a wider audience while streamlining development processes and reducing costs.

Web technologies play a crucial role in building apps that run on different platforms, leveraging HTML, CSS, and JavaScript to ensure seamless functionality across Android, iOS, and Windows. This approach not only simplifies the development process but also provides access to device-specific functions through JavaScript APIs.

Dart

.Net MAUI

Ionic

Why choose Invatechs as a Cross-platform application development company

Our company has been engaged in cross-platform development for over 10 years, leveraging the latest in platform app development framework technology. This expertise allows us to create native mobile applications for multiple platforms without the need for separate native apps for each, streamlining the development process significantly. During this time, we have created an impressive number of solutions that help our clients stay competitive in their business niche. Our experts are constantly developing and learning in order to create only the best and most effective products. In addition, you also get the following range of benefits when cooperating with us:

  • Relieve your employees from routine tasks that our specialists can do;

  • The most innovative solutions that will make your application a leader in your niche;

  • Entire development cycle with optimization, testing, and further support;

  • You will get individual terms and a detailed roadmap for the implementation of the product.

office
close-up-hands-holding-smartphon

Don’t know where to start?

Get a Cross-platform app solution from our experts

Cost of Cross-platform app development services

Our effective solutions are aimed at creating user-friendly and functional platforms and websites. Professionals from Invatechs use the most cutting-edge techniques to deploy and improve web products. The main areas of website development services are listed below:

Our effective solutions are aimed at creating user-friendly and functional platforms and websites. Professionals from Invatechs use the most cutting-edge techniques to deploy and improve web products.

 

Invatechs is fully focused on long-term cooperation with our customers. We offer some of the most effective cross-platform application development services. Which are of Western European quality and Central European prices. We work with clients all over the world and are always happy to have a long-term partnership. Here are the main pricing factors of our services:

 

  • Project size and complexity

  • The size of the team of specialists

  • Experience of the employees

What our customers think

teenagers-using-mobile-phones

FAQ

  • What is web development?
    Web development refers to the process of creating, building, and maintaining websites or web applications. It involves various tasks such as designing web pages, programming functionality, and ensuring the website's performance and usability.
  • What are the key components of web development?
    Key components of web development include web design, programming languages, database management, server-side scripting, client-side scripting, and content management systems (CMS).
  • What is the difference between web development and web design?
    Web development involves the technical aspects of building and maintaining websites or web applications, including programming and functionality implementation. Web design focuses on the visual aspects of a website, such as layout, color schemes, and typography.
  • What is responsive web design?
    Responsive web design is an approach to designing and developing websites that ensure optimal viewing and interaction across various devices and screen sizes. It involves creating flexible layouts and using CSS media queries to adjust the design based on the device's screen size.
  • How important is search engine optimization (SEO) in web development?
    SEO is crucial in web development as it helps improve a website's visibility and ranking in search engine results pages (SERPs). Proper implementation of SEO techniques ensures that the website attracts organic traffic and reaches its target audience effectively.
  • What programming languages are commonly used in web development?
    Commonly used programming languages in web development include HTML (Hypertext Markup Language), CSS (Cascading Style Sheets), JavaScript, PHP (Hypertext Preprocessor), Python, and Ruby.
  • What is the difference between front-end and back-end development?
    Front-end development involves building the user interface and client-side functionality of a website, while back-end development focuses on server-side logic and database management to support the front-end functionality.
  • What is a content management system (CMS)?
    A content management system (CMS) is a software application that allows users to create, manage, and publish digital content on websites without requiring technical expertise. Popular CMS platforms include WordPress, Joomla, and Drupal.
  • How does web development support e-commerce businesses?
    Web development plays a critical role in e-commerce by enabling the creation of online stores, product catalogs, shopping carts, payment gateways, and order management systems to facilitate online transactions and sales.
  • What role does quality assurance play in web development?
    Quality assurance ensures that websites and web applications meet specified requirements, function properly, and provide a seamless user experience. It involves testing for bugs, errors, and usability issues to ensure the overall quality and reliability of the web product.
bottom of page